What You'll Need

Before you start painting your melamine cabinets, you'll need to gather the necessary tools and supplies. Here's a list of what you'll need:

Tools:

  • Screwdriver
  • Sanding block or sandpaper
  • Paintbrushes
  • Roller
  • Paint sprayer (optional)

Supplies:

  • Primer
  • Paint
  • Painter's tape
  • Tack cloth
  • Deglosser (optional)

The Process

Now that you have everything you need, let's get started on painting your melamine cabinets. Here are the steps to follow:

Step 1: Remove the Cabinet Doors and Hardware

Using your screwdriver, remove the cabinet doors and hardware, including knobs, handles, and hinges. Place them in a safe place where they won't get lost or damaged.

Step 2: Clean and Degrease the Cabinets

Clean the cabinets with warm water and a mild detergent, then use a degreaser to remove any stubborn stains or grease buildup. Wipe the cabinets down with a tack cloth to remove any remaining dust or debris.

Step 3: Sand the Cabinets

Using a sanding block or sandpaper, lightly sand the cabinets to create a rough surface that the primer can adhere to. Be sure to sand in the direction of the grain and wipe away any dust with a tack cloth.

Step 4: Apply Primer

Apply a coat of primer to the cabinets using a paintbrush or roller. If you're using a paint sprayer, follow the manufacturer's instructions. Allow the primer to dry completely before moving on to the next step.

Step 5: Paint the Cabinets

Apply a coat of paint to the cabinets using a paintbrush or roller. Again, if you're using a paint sprayer, follow the manufacturer's instructions. Allow the first coat of paint to dry completely before applying a second coat.

Step 6: Reinstall the Cabinet Doors and Hardware

Once the paint has dried, reattach the cabinet doors and hardware using your screwdriver.

Tips and Tricks

Here are some tips and tricks to keep in mind when painting your melamine cabinets:
  • Choose a high-quality paint and primer that are specifically designed for melamine surfaces.
  • Use a deglosser to create a smoother surface for the primer to adhere to.
  • Be patient and allow each coat of paint to dry completely before applying the next coat.
  • Consider adding a clear coat of sealer to protect the paint and increase durability.
